Factors to Consider in BP Tattoo Designs

Selecting the perfect body placement involves multiple considerations beyond mere aesthetics. Pain tolerance, skin texture, and personal comfort play significant roles in determining the ideal location for your tattoo. Some areas are more sensitive than others, and the body’s natural contours can enhance or detract from the design’s overall impact.

Body Area Pain Level Design Suitability
Ribs High Intricate, Linear Designs
Outer Arm Low Bold, Large Designs
Inner Ankle Moderate Small, Delicate Artwork

How painful are different body placements for tattoos?


+


Pain varies by individual, but generally, areas with more fat and muscle like outer arms are less painful, while bony or sensitive areas like ribs and ankles tend to be more uncomfortable.






How do I choose the right body placement for my tattoo?


+


Consider factors like design size, personal pain tolerance, professional environment, and how visible you want the tattoo to be. Consult with a professional tattoo artist for personalized advice.






Do tattoo placements affect healing time?


+


Yes, areas with more movement or friction can take longer to heal. Areas like hands, feet, and joints typically require more careful aftercare and may heal more slowly compared to less mobile body parts.
